Date | Name | Activity | Value |
---|---|---|---|
Jun 06, 2025 | xxxxxxxxxxxxx | $47500 | |
May 30, 2025 | xxxxxxxxxxxxx | $164700 | |
May 28, 2025 | xxxxxxxxxxxxx | $54000 | |
May 23, 2025 | xxxxxxxxxxxxx | $179800 |
Date | Firm | Activity | Value |
---|---|---|---|
Mar 31, 2025 | xxxxxxxxxxxxx | $5726225 | |
Mar 31, 2025 | xxxxxxxxxxxxx | $12232684 | |
Mar 31, 2025 | xxxxxxxxxxxxx | $30155054 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
16,228,415 | Institution | 13.67% | 154,494,511 | |
13,689,716 | Institution | 11.53% | 130,326,096 | |
10,308,663 | Institution | 8.69% | 98,138,472 | |
5,521,949 | Institution | 4.65% | 52,568,954 | |
4,648,613 | Institution | 3.92% | 44,254,796 | |
4,182,733 | Institution | 3.52% | 39,819,618 | |
2,976,807 | Institution | 2.51% | 28,339,203 | |
2,340,967 | Institution | 1.97% | 22,286,006 | |
2,004,137 | Institution | 1.69% | 19,079,384 | |
1,825,110 | Insider | 1.54% | 17,375,047 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
10,308,663 | Institution | 8.69% | 98,138,472 | |
5,521,949 | Institution | 4.65% | 52,568,954 | |
4,648,613 | Institution | 3.92% | 44,254,796 | |
4,182,733 | Institution | 3.52% | 39,819,618 | |
1,569,368 | Institution | 1.32% | 14,940,383 | |
1,117,199 | Institution | 0.94% | 10,635,734 | |
1,111,922 | Institution | 0.94% | 10,585,497 | |
1,027,225 | Institution | 0.87% | 9,779,182 | |
955,612 | Institution | 0.81% | 9,097,426 | |
912,850 | Institution | 0.77% | 8,690,332 |
Holder | # of Shares | Type | % Holding | Value |
---|---|---|---|---|
7,140,416 | Institution | 6.02% | 67,976,760 | |
5,137,194 | Institution | 4.33% | 47,159,441 | |
3,826,671 | Institution | 3.22% | 35,128,840 | |
3,018,408 | Institution | 2.54% | 27,708,985 | |
3,008,624 | Institution | 2.53% | 28,642,100 | |
1,860,496 | Institution | 1.57% | 17,079,353 | |
1,672,605 | Institution | 1.41% | 15,354,514 | |
1,064,327 | Institution | 0.90% | 10,132,393 | |
1,016,441 | Institution | 0.86% | 9,107,311 | |
736,125 | Institution | 0.62% | 7,007,910 |